How do I find out which Social Security Disability attorneys take my case?

If you live in Washington and are looking for a Social Security Disability lawyer to take your case, there are a few different ways to go about finding the right one. The most important thing to do is research attorneys who specialize in this area of the law. Start by talking to friends or family who may have used an attorney or researching online. You can also contact the local bar association or the State Bar of Washington, as they may have a list of qualified attorneys. Once you’ve identified a few potential attorneys, it’s important to do some research on each one. Look at their reviews online, check out their website, and read up on their background and qualifications. It’s also a good idea to contact the attorneys and ask some questions. You can ask about their experience in the field, the types of Social Security Disability cases they have handled, and any fees or costs associated with taking on your case. Don’t be afraid to shop around or speak to more than one attorney before making a decision. Your decision should ultimately be based on who you feel comfortable with and who you feel can best represent your interests.
